Description: Scada-LTS is an open-source SCADA (Supervisory Control and Data Acquisition) software used to monitor and control industrial, infrastructure and facility-based processes. It provides real-time data visualization, alarm notifications, data logging and reporting.

Description: FreeSCADA is an open-source SCADA (Supervisory Control and Data Acquisition) software system. It is used to monitor and control industrial, infrastructure, and facility-based processes such as manufacturing, production, power generation, fabrication, and refining.

Pros & Cons Analysis

Scada-LTS
Scada-LTS
Pros
  • Open source
  • Free to use
  • Cross-platform (Windows, Linux, macOS)
  • Modular and customizable
  • Supports industry standard protocols (Modbus, OPC)
  • Scalable
Cons
  • Limited technical support compared to commercial SCADA
  • Steeper learning curve than some commercial options
  • Not as feature rich as some commercial SCADA software
  • Lacks built-in redundancy features
FreeSCADA
FreeSCADA
Pros
  • Free and open source
  • Cross-platform (Windows, Linux, etc)
  • Modular and customizable architecture
  • Supports numerous communication protocols and standards
  • Active community support
Cons
  • Limited documentation
  • Steep learning curve
  • Not as full-featured as commercial SCADA platforms
  • Lacks some ready-made drivers
